WebReflection is a type of transformation. To reflect an object, you need a mirror line. When a shape is reflected, its size does not change - the image just appears 'flipped'. WebReflectivity is the ratio of the power of the reflected wave to that of the incident wave. It is a function of the wavelength of radiation, and is related to the refractive index of the material as expressed by Fresnel's equations. [12]
WebA reflex angle is an angle that lies between 180° and 360°. A reflex angle and the corresponding angle that lies on the other side of it together form a complete angle of 360°.
